Abstract Dislocation arrangements in plastically deformed austenitio stainless steel developed under tension have been compared with those resulting from compression. The effect of stress mode and orientation on substructure has been interpreted as an efiect of applied stress on the equilibrium separation of Shockley partial dislocations and thereby on the extent of cross slip.
